MOONTON Games, in partnership with smartphone brand realme, has introduced two new initiatives to spotlight the power of storytelling and technology in the world of esports. As part of the ongoing M7 World Championship (M7), the company has announced the return of the Mobile Legends: Bang Bang (MLBB) Media Championship (MMC) and the launch of the M7 Awards for Best Media, honouring the work of journalists and content creators who bring the MLBB esports scene to life.

MOONTON announces MLBB M7 Media Championship and Awards

These programmes will run alongside the M7, which is set to be the biggest M Series event to date. From 3 to 25 January, the championship takes place in Indonesia — the heartland of MLBB esports — for the first time since M4. Indonesia has consistently topped esports viewership charts, with the MPL Indonesia surpassing 100 million hours watched across its last five seasons.

According to Esports ChartsMLBB dominated 2024 as the most-watched mobile esports title, amassing over 475 million hours watched, driven largely by the record-breaking success of the M6 World Championship, which crossed 85 million hours watched.

Honoring the Media’s Role through MMC

Guided by the theme #LetTheWorldSeeUs, the MLBB Media Championship seeks to celebrate the vital contributions of esports media professionals. Through this unique tournament, participating media will gain a first-hand look at the competitive and technological foundations that define MLBB esports.

Adrian Cher, Global Head of Partnerships for MLBB Esports at MOONTON Games, emphasized the importance of media in shaping esports culture.

“The MMC allows us to highlight the ecosystem behind MLBB Esports. It’s not just about the players and teams—it’s also about how technology and media together make esports stories resonate globally,” said Adrian.

realme’s Head of Gaming Business Line, Daogen Qin, echoed this sentiment, adding: “realme is thrilled to power the MMC with our latest smartphone, the realme 15 Pro. Its advanced gaming capabilities will enable media to experience how innovation drives mobile esports forward.”

Up to eight media teams will compete onsite during the M7 Knockout Stage, battling it out across elimination rounds and the Grand Finals. The winning team will receive five realme smartphones and the largest share of a 270,000 Diamond prize pool. The inaugural MMC, held during the M6 in 2024, saw Malaysia’s WTM Today claim the title.

realme and MOONTON Celebrate the Art of Esports Journalism

Complementing the tournament, MOONTON Games has unveiled the M7 Awards for Best Media, supported by realme. This awards programme will recognise exceptional storytelling, reporting, and long-form coverage that have helped shape the MLBB esports landscape across three distinct categories:

  • Trendspotter Award by realme – For journalists or publications producing the most engaging and timely stories highlighting MLBB and M7.
  • Best in Esports Business Journalism Award by realme – For reporting that explores the business side of esports, including partnerships, innovation, and market trends.
  • Outstanding Feature Award by realme – For excellence in long-form storytelling and impactful editorial coverage centered on MLBB and the M7 season.

Winners in each category will be honoured with certificates of recognition50,000 Diamonds, and a new realme smartphone, empowering them to continue creating high-quality esports content.

Reflecting on the initiative, Adrian Cher stated: “Esports thrives because of the people who tell its stories. The M7 Awards celebrate those writers and creators who define MLBB’s legacy through their words and coverage. With realme’s support, we aim to uplift the voices shaping the future of our community.”
